Section I

How to Apply

For forms see www.aljfoundation.org.

On Unsolicited Proposals yes

Restrictions

Organization must: 1) Facilitate providing the handicapped with animals that assist with daily living or 2) Contribute to or facilitate nature and/or wildlife preservation.
